What is the fleshy product of a plant usually covering the seeds called?

The fleshy product of a plant covering the seeds is called a fruit. Fruits are typically formed from the ovary of a flowering plant and contain seeds for reproduction. Some fruits are sweet and edible, while others may be dry or used for propagation.

Are there edible plants in Antarctica?

Yes there is an edible plant in Antarctica. The sub-Antarctic edible plant is known as Kerguelen Cabbage.


What are woodbine berries?

Woodbine is another name for the climbing plant which is usually called Honeysuckle. It has berries but they are not edible.


What is edible part of radish?

It is the taproot of the radish that is usually eaten. The entire plant is edible and the tops can be used as a leaf vegetable. The seed can also be sprouted and eaten raw.
